Born Fred McDowell in Rossville, Tennessee on January 12, 1904, the blues singer-songwriter and guitarist was better known by his stage name Mississippi Fred McDowell. A blues icon, he is acknowledged as the father of North Mississippi Hill Country blues. He began his musical journey when he started playing guitar at 14, using a slide made from a beef rib bone. He would later switch to using a glass slide. Mississippi Fred McDowell worked on a farm and did other odd jobs while performing for decades at local gatherings and parties in Como, Mississippi.
